Chemical and Toxicological Studies of the Phytotoxin, 6α,7β,9α-Trihydroxy-8(14), 15-isopimaradiene-20,6-γ-lactone, Produced by a Parasitic Fungus, Phomopsis sp., in Wilting Pine Trees

1986 
A phytotoxin, isopimarane diterpene γ-lactol, 6α,7β,9α-trihydroxy-8 (14),15-isopimaradiene- 20,6-γ-lactone, was isolated from the culture filtrate of the fungus Phomopsis sp., which was obtained from the interior part of the trunk of most wilting Japanese red pines, Pinus densiflora I Sieb, et Zucc. The stereostructure was established by X-ray crystal analysis and spectroanalysis. This γ-lactol was identical with LL-S491, a fermentation product of the fungus Aspergillus chevalieri. The cytotoxic activity of the γ-lactol isopimarane was the same as pentachlorophenol at 150 ppm on cell cultures from Japanese red pine buds.
